To power a central air system during a power outage, the whole-house generator will need to be at least 5,000 watts, and this number will significantly increase for larger units. Check the specific wattage requirements of your AC unit to choose the right generator size. Consider consulting a generator installer to ensure your whole-house generator meets your electrical load needs.

It is safe to run a generator continuously, but you must follow safety protocols to ensure personal and home safety. Read the manufacturer’s instructions for specific recommendations, but the general recommendation is to turn generators off overnight or when you’re away from the house. Overworked generators can pose a fire hazard and if your generator is not in a well-ventilated area, running it continuously could lead to carbon monoxide poisoning.

While the rating will tell you how many watts the refrigerator needs at the peak of its cycle, it requires additional wattage to start. At the bare minimum, you’ll need a 1,500-watt generator to get the fridge up and running after a blackout. A 2,000-watt generator should be sufficient for most home refrigerators.

Whole-house generators need to be installed on level ground several feet away from walls and other objects. Because they tap into the electrical system directly, they usually need to be close to your home electrical panel for a transfer switch installation. It also helps with installation if they are near to a gas line or propane tank installation.

To determine the right size generator for your house, you should calculate the total wattage of the appliances and devices you want to power during an outage. List all essential items, note their start-up wattages, and add them together.

Here are some typical wattage requirements for common appliances:

  • Refrigerator: 600 watts

  • Large dehumidifier: 700 watts

  • Large window air conditioner: 1,400 watts

  • Water heater: 3,000 to 4,500 watts

  • Electric furnace: 5,000 to 25,000 watts

A 7,500-watt generator might be sufficient for essentials like a refrigerator, freezer, well pump, and lighting circuits. However, for high-demand items like a water heater or furnace, a whole-home generator is a better choice. A portable generator may be enough if you only need to power a few critical items.

While home square footage can offer a rough estimate, it is not always a reliable indicator. For reference, here are some typical generator sizes based on square footage:

  • 1,000 sq ft: 6–9 kW

  • 1,500 sq ft: 7–10 kW

  • 2,000 sq ft: 10–14 kW

  • 2,500 sq ft: 12–16 kW

  • 3,000 sq ft: 16–20 kW+

For the most accurate sizing, consult a professional who can calculate your home's peak and average power consumption and recommend the optimal generator.
